  • PDF links to a 'free generator / game hack' redirector critical PDF_GAME_HACK_REDIRECT_LURE
    PDF's clickable action targets a redirector of the form /app/<id>/<slug>-game-hack — the landing-page shape of a large SEO 'free spins / generator / game hack' lure family that funnels victims through rotating disposable hosts to a malware/scam payload. The multi-link variants also trip ML/link-farm rules; this catches the single-link variants that otherwise score clean. CRITICAL on its own: the /app/<id>/<slug>-game-hack path shape is unambiguous scam infra, and the host rotates so a host-list match can't be relied on.
  • PDF links to known malicious redirector infrastructure critical PDF_MALICIOUS_REDIRECTOR_LINK
    PDF contains a clickable URI to redirector infrastructure used by a known malicious PDF SEO/adware delivery campaign. These documents typically rely on user interaction and redirect chains rather than a PDF parser vulnerability.
